
Over seven months, Jane contributed to Techtonica’s curriculum and techtonica.org repositories, focusing on backend development, DevOps, and documentation. She modernized deployment pipelines and Docker workflows, improved database integration using Python and SQLAlchemy, and streamlined environment configuration for both local and production setups. Jane enhanced onboarding by refining documentation and clarifying PostgreSQL Docker installation guides, reducing setup friction for new developers. Her work included dynamic UI rendering, robust date handling, and improved error management, all while maintaining code quality through linting and pre-commit hooks. These efforts resulted in more reliable deployments, maintainable codebases, and a smoother developer experience across projects.

Monthly summary for 2025-08 focusing on Techtonica/curriculum contributions, highlighting feature delivery, impact, and skills demonstrated.
Monthly summary for 2025-08 focusing on Techtonica/curriculum contributions, highlighting feature delivery, impact, and skills demonstrated.
July 2025 monthly summary for Techtonica/curriculum: Delivered targeted improvements to the PostgreSQL Docker installation guide, including clarified steps, a corrected placeholder email, and expanded guidance for connecting to PostgreSQL via pgAdmin. These updates streamline local DB setup, reduce onboarding time, and minimize confusion during first-run setup, strengthening developer experience and reducing support friction.
July 2025 monthly summary for Techtonica/curriculum: Delivered targeted improvements to the PostgreSQL Docker installation guide, including clarified steps, a corrected placeholder email, and expanded guidance for connecting to PostgreSQL via pgAdmin. These updates streamline local DB setup, reduce onboarding time, and minimize confusion during first-run setup, strengthening developer experience and reducing support friction.
April 2025 monthly summary for Techtonica/techtonica.org: Focused on stabilizing the build and deployment pipelines and simplifying environment setup to improve reliability, onboarding, and developer productivity. Delivered two main features with traceable commits and centralized documentation to reduce maintenance overhead and environment drift. The work reinforces business value by speeding deployments, ensuring consistent dev/prod parity, and enabling faster iteration for product features.
April 2025 monthly summary for Techtonica/techtonica.org: Focused on stabilizing the build and deployment pipelines and simplifying environment setup to improve reliability, onboarding, and developer productivity. Delivered two main features with traceable commits and centralized documentation to reduce maintenance overhead and environment drift. The work reinforces business value by speeding deployments, ensuring consistent dev/prod parity, and enabling faster iteration for product features.
March 2025 delivered a robust foundation for date handling, deployment readiness, and database readiness, while elevating code quality and security. Key outcomes include improved date handling and formatting, explicit application open dates and timeline alignment, hardened environment/configuration, and groundwork for scalable database integration, all backed by stronger error handling and developer tooling.
March 2025 delivered a robust foundation for date handling, deployment readiness, and database readiness, while elevating code quality and security. Key outcomes include improved date handling and formatting, explicit application open dates and timeline alignment, hardened environment/configuration, and groundwork for scalable database integration, all backed by stronger error handling and developer tooling.
February 2025: Focused on delivering data-driven UI improvements, strengthening code quality, and hardening data handling to improve reliability and business value. Key features were implemented with an emphasis on dynamic rendering, modularization of timeline data, and export readiness, while bugs affecting data defaults and UI behavior were addressed to improve stability and user experience.
February 2025: Focused on delivering data-driven UI improvements, strengthening code quality, and hardening data handling to improve reliability and business value. Key features were implemented with an emphasis on dynamic rendering, modularization of timeline data, and export readiness, while bugs affecting data defaults and UI behavior were addressed to improve stability and user experience.
January 2025 (2025-01) Techtonica.org: Delivered targeted modernization of dependencies and tooling alongside developer-experience improvements. The work reduces technical debt, improves reliability, and accelerates future development cycles by keeping the stack current and clarifying local development and CI processes.
January 2025 (2025-01) Techtonica.org: Delivered targeted modernization of dependencies and tooling alongside developer-experience improvements. The work reduces technical debt, improves reliability, and accelerates future development cycles by keeping the stack current and clarifying local development and CI processes.
December 2024: Focused on documentation quality, workflow guidance, and code hygiene in Techtonica/curriculum. Delivered comprehensive documentation refinements, clarified user-facing copy across lessons, added workflow testing notes, updated the 2025 H1 participant file, and modernized the codebase by replacing deprecated var with let and cleaning up unused references. The work improves onboarding, reduces ambiguity in PRs, and lowers technical debt, while preserving repository readability and consistency across materials.
December 2024: Focused on documentation quality, workflow guidance, and code hygiene in Techtonica/curriculum. Delivered comprehensive documentation refinements, clarified user-facing copy across lessons, added workflow testing notes, updated the 2025 H1 participant file, and modernized the codebase by replacing deprecated var with let and cleaning up unused references. The work improves onboarding, reduces ambiguity in PRs, and lowers technical debt, while preserving repository readability and consistency across materials.
Overview of all repositories you've contributed to across your timeline